NEET PG 2023 Result: Aarushi Narwani Tops Medical Exam, Secures 725 Out Of 800

NEET PG 2023 Result

NEET PG 2023 Result Latest Update: Notably, Aarushi Narwani scored a total of 725 marks out of 800 while Prem Tilak scored 700 marks.

NEET PG 2023 Result Latest Update: The National Board of Examinations (NBE) released the NEET PG 2023 results on its official website, nbe.edu.in, on Tuesday evening. This year, a total of 2,08,898 NEET PG applicants had appeared for the exam on March 5, 2023.

  • Aarushi Narwani from VMMC & SAFDARJUNG Hospital in New Delhi won the NEET PG 2023 all-India competition, and Prem Tilak came in second place, according to the results posted on the official website.
  • Notably, Prem Tilak received 700 marks, while Aarushi Narwani received a total of 725 out of 800.

  • The NBEMS in the official notice noted that the board will be releasing the all-India 50% quota merit list separately.
  • The notice further stated, “The States/UT shall create the Final Merit List/category wise Merit List for State Quota Seats in accordance with their qualifying/ eligibility criteria, applicable guidelines/ laws & reservation policy.
  • The Medical Counselling Committee will conduct the NEET PG counselling process in 2023, and those who pass the exam will be entitled to participate (MCC).
